Shopify Vs WooCommerce
Shopify vs. WooCommerce. Choosing the right ecommerce platform for your business
For ecommerce business owners, choosing the right platform is one of the most foundational decisions you’ll make. It impacts everything from your site’s functionality and user experience to how easily you manage operations behind the scenes.
Two of the most popular ecommerce platforms on the market today – Shopify and WooCommerce – offer powerful features, but cater to different needs and business styles.

THQ helps merchants on both platforms, and in this article, we’ll break down the core differences, strengths, and trade-offs between Shopify and WooCommerce.
We want to help you understand both platforms and be better placed to decide which one best suits your goals and ecommerce business model.
Platform type and setup
Shopify is a fully hosted platform. That means everything from hosting and security to updates and backups, is centralised, curated, quality controlled and managed for you. It’s an all-in-one solution designed to make it possible to launch an ecomm brand quickly, with minimal technical know-how.
WooCommerce, on the other hand, is a self-hosted plugin built on the WordPress CMS. This gives you full control and flexibility, but it also means you’re responsible for hosting, security, and maintenance. WooCommerce offers more customisation out of the box, but typically requires more setup time and technical involvement.
Snapshot
- Shopify is turnkey, ideal for business owners who want a streamlined start and managed infrastructure.
- WooCommerce offers deep flexibility for those comfortable managing their own systems or working with a developer.
Ease of use
Shopify is known for its ease of use. The dashboard is intuitive, the onboarding is smooth, and all sorts of support is readily available. Tasks like adding products, managing orders, and tracking inventory are straightforward and user-friendly.
WooCommerce, while highly capable, has a steeper learning curve. Managing a WooCommerce store often means dealing with WordPress plugins, themes, and server settings. If you or your team have experience with WordPress, it can feel natural. If not, there will be a learning period, or the need to have external specialists ready to help you.
Snapshot
- Shopify is easier to use out of the box, especially for non-technical users.
- WooCommerce offers more control but can require more time and technical comfort to manage.
Design and customisation
Shopify offers a robust theme store with professionally designed templates that are responsive and optimised. Customisation is possible through the theme editor, and more advanced changes can be made via Shopify’s Liquid code. However, Shopify can feel limiting if you want total freedom in design or functionality.
WooCommerce benefits from the massive WordPress ecosystem, allowing almost unlimited customisation. With access to thousands of themes and plugins, and full access to code, you can build practically anything. This is ideal for businesses with unique needs or a strong brand vision.
Snapshot
- Shopify is perfect for polished, professional sites with limited need for custom functionality.
- WooCommerce is ideal for businesses that want complete creative and functional freedom.
Features and functionality
Shopify includes most of the essential ecommerce features out of the box. That is, inventory management, order processing, multi-channel selling (including social and marketplaces), and excellent reporting. It also has a large app marketplace for added features like subscriptions, reviews, or advanced analytics.
WooCommerce is modular by design. The core plugin is lightweight, and you can extend its capabilities through plugins. This makes it extremely adaptable, and allows you to create a membership site, sell bookings, or offer advanced product customisation. There are plugins for all of those features. But keep in mind that managing multiple plugins will increase the overall complexity of your ecosystem, and increase the risks of compatibility issues.
Snapshot
- Shopify offers built-in tools and curated apps for straightforward scaling.
- WooCommerce provides more feature flexibility—but requires careful plugin management.
Integrations and ecosystem
Shopify’s app ecosystem is tightly controlled, which can be a good thing, because it ensures quality and reliability, in much the same way as Apple products. You’ll find integrations with marketing tools, CRMs, shipping solutions, and accounting platforms like QuickBooks and Xero. These are typically plug-and-play, with strong support.
WooCommerce integrates with just about anything, thanks to the broader WordPress and open-source developer communities. Whether you need multilingual support, complex tax settings, or region-specific gateways, chances are it’s available. But you’ll often need to test, configure, and sometimes tweak things to get them working smoothly.
Snapshot
- Shopify’s integrations are polished and supported.
- WooCommerce’s integration potential is broader but may require more technical involvement.
Scalability and performance
Shopify handles performance and scaling behind the scenes. As your traffic grows, Shopify’s infrastructure grows with you, and there is no need to manage servers or optimise performance. This reliability is one of Shopify’s greatest strengths, especially for fast-growing businesses.
WooCommerce gives you more flexibility in how you scale, but the responsibility is yours (or your developer’s). You’ll need to monitor hosting, optimise your site for speed, and ensure your plugins stay up to date. That said, WooCommerce can scale just as effectively, with the right setup and support.
Snapshot
- Shopify handles scaling for you.
- WooCommerce can scale powerfully—but requires proactive technical management.
Which platform is right for you?
Here’s where we help you to understand when these two platforms might be right for your brand and business.
Choose Shopify when:
- You want to launch quickly without technical setup.
- You prefer a user-friendly dashboard and reliable support.
- Your business model fits within conventional ecommerce (physical or digital goods).
- You’re growing fast and need a platform that ‘just works.’
Choose WooCommerce when:
- You want total control over every aspect of your store.
- You already use (or like) WordPress.
- Your ecommerce model requires custom functionality or design.
- You’re comfortable managing—or have help managing—hosting, plugins, and maintenance.
Timing and business fit
- Startups and solo entrepreneurs often benefit from Shopify’s ease and speed. It allows you to focus on growing your business rather than managing tech.
- Established brands or niche businesses that need advanced custom features, unique checkout experiences, or integration with specialised systems often lean toward WooCommerce.
- Agencies and developers may prefer WooCommerce for client projects that demand full design or backend flexibility.
- Businesses entering a scaling phase, especially those expanding into multiple sales channels or international markets, may find Shopify’s managed infrastructure a safer bet.
Summary and conclusion
Both Shopify and WooCommerce are powerful ecommerce platforms with distinct strengths.
The best choice depends on your technical preferences, customisation needs, and business stage. If you’re seeking a streamlined, reliable, and managed platform, Shopify may be your match. If control, flexibility, and customization top your list, WooCommerce could be the better fit.Take time to consider where your business is now, and where it’s heading. The right platform will not only meet your needs today but support your growth tomorrow.
